published on: 2015-05-18 01:07:41
mobrienorwhatever: Michael Brown Jr. (May 20, 1996 – August
helmut lang ss14.
forget me
darksilenceinsuburbia: Ai Wei Wei: The Wave, 2005
alongtimealone: Tove-Jansson
raxxandtraxx: Wishing